The send Notification checkbox only related to the fact that the change of the Label(s) should trigger the normal notification flow of JIRA. Same flow as when you would edit other fields of the issue.
So this notification is specific to the issue that's being labeled.
If you want to get a notification for every issue that receives a particular label, you'll have to create filter like this:
labels = "<label>"
When you have saved the filter you can click on Details and create Subscription. More details here: https://confluence.atlassian.com/display/JIRA/Receiving+Search+Results+via+Email#ReceivingSearchResultsviaEmail-SubscribingtoaFilter

Hi Mauro,
Open an existing ticket, click the More drop-down and select Labels. Beneath the label name is a checkbox labeled Send Notification. I just want to know what happens if that is checked. When are notifications sent if it is checked?

Thanks for explaining. I found it :)
And yes, those notifications should be sent within the minute as all other notifications. You can check the mail queue (type 'gg queue') to see if emails are being sent.
